Determine 1 Synthesis and degradation of ACh. ACh is synthesized from Acetyl-S-CoA and choline because of the choline acetyltransferase (ChAT) enzyme during the cytoplasm. ACh is secreted out instantly immediately after synthesis in non-immune cells but stored in the specialised vesicle in neuronal cells secreted at presynaptic neurons just after activation. Launch of ACh demands an influx of Ca2+ ion inside the cells followed by docking of ACh-containing vesicle docking at membrane and fusion and release of neurotransmitter in to the synaptic cleft by way of a approach often called exocytosis.

ACh is synthesized in cholinergic neurons (such as Individuals inside the nucleus basalis of Meynert) from choline and acetyl-CoA utilizing an enzyme identified as choline acetyltransferase.

When acetylcholine binds to acetylcholine receptors on skeletal muscle mass fibers, it opens ligand-gated sodium channels during the mobile membrane. Sodium ions then enter the muscle cell, initiating a sequence of actions that eventually generate muscle mass contraction.

The subunits with the nicotinic receptors belong to a multigene household (sixteen associates in individuals) along with the assembly of combinations of subunits ends in a lot of various receptors (for more information see the Ligand-Gated Ion Channel database). These receptors, with extremely variable kinetic, electrophysiological and pharmacological Homes, respond to nicotine in a different way, at incredibly unique successful concentrations. This functional diversity lets them to take part in two key types of neurotransmission. Classical synaptic transmission (wiring transmission) requires the release of higher concentrations of neurotransmitter, acting on promptly neighboring receptors.

[17] This binding helps prevent subsequent activation from the receptor though succinylcholine is bound; it is often often called a “depolarizing neuromuscular blocker” resulting from First receptor activation and subsequent membrane depolarization. On the other hand, the tubocurarine class of drugs including rocuronium, vecuronium, and atracurium falls while in the category of “non-depolarizing brokers.” These brokers act by way of competitive inhibition, occupying the Energetic receptor web page and preventing acetylcholine binding and activation.[18]

Within the digestive method, receptor activation stimulates intestinal motility and digestive enzyme secretion. Receptor activation in the lungs contributes to clean muscle contraction, narrowing the airways, and rising secretion generation. Also, muscarinic receptors are existing through the central anxious program and also have demonstrated critical functions in both equally Understanding and memory. Animal styles missing the M1 receptor create deficiencies in each cognition and very long-term potentiation.
